Physics and Physiology of Decompression

Decompression involves a complex interaction of gas solubility, partial pressures and concentration gradients, bulk transport and bubble mechanics in living tissues.

This section provides an introductory discussion of some of the factors influencing inert gas uptake and elimination in living tissues.
